Advanced testing of F1 paddock 'key' to starting season
Racing Point team boss Otmar Szafnauer says advanced virus testing of members of the paddock will be a key requirement for starting the F1 season. Formula 1 is planning to return to action in early July in Austria behind closed doors if current lockdown measures linked to the coronavirus continue to be eased across Europe and in the UK in the coming months. Local health guidelines will likely be in force at each event, but Szafnauer says it's better to be safe than sorry, insisting F1 will also need to test its community ahead of its first race to minimize risks of contagion in the paddock.
